Subject matter
The sander held powdered gum sandarac, a fine sand which was sprinkled on unglazed paper to prevent smearing. The sand would be poured back once the ink was dry, ready for reuse.

Physical Description
This is a silver-plated sander with a s-shaped handle. It has a circular base that narrows at the top. The lid has a beaded decoration on the rim and small holes.
